About Dr. Augustina Kwesie Osabutey

Dr. Augustina Kwesie Osabutey is an author, environmental engineer, educator, and clean water advocate dedicated to advancing environmental sustainability and youth development. Her work brings together scientific training, literacy, and community engagement to inspire children and communities to protect the Earth.

Academic Background

  • PhD — Agricultural, Biosystems & Mechanical Engineering, South Dakota State University

  • Master of Science — Environmental Engineering, Montana Technological University

  • Master’s Certificate — Ecological Restoration, Montana Technological University

  • Bachelor of Science — Mechanical Engineering, University of Mines and Technology (UMaT), Ghana

Expertise

  • Water and wastewater treatment

  • Water quality analysis

  • Drinking water and wastewater compliance

  • Industrial permitting

  • Ecological restoration

  • Environmental sustainability education

  • Community environmental programming

Founder – Teen Lead Foundation

Established in Ghana in 2016 and expanded to the U.S. in 2024, Teen Lead Foundation empowers children and teens through environmental literacy, leadership, and entrepreneurship programs. The Foundation has reached over 10,000 children through in-person and virtual initiatives.
